  • Author of Rich Dad, Poor Dad, Robert Kiyosaki sees the market crash as an opportunity to get richer:

  • Robert Kiyosaki, author of the best-selling book Rich Dad, Poor Dad, has a unique perspective on the market crash. He believes that in times of chaos, the brave get richer and the cowards get poorer.

  • What Happened: Kiyosaki took to the X website to share his thoughts on the current market situation. He expressed excitement about the market crash, saying that this is an opportunity to buy more BTC/USD bitcoins, gold and silver. He also urged investors to stay calm and invest when others get out of the game.

  • Crash is the time when brave people get richer and cowards get poorer..... Because they sell or do nothing. The world is full of poor cowards. Be smarter. Be brave, be calm and invest when the cowards leave. Take care of yourselves, Kiyosaki wrote. His comments came amid a significant market downturn that has spread around the world. This situation has caused concern among leading financial experts, some of whom have warned of a worsening market downturn.

  • Why it matters: Kiyosaki's views on the market crash are consistent with his recent statements. Just a few days ago, he called the recent stock market crash an opportunity for wealth accumulation and repeated his "rich daddy" admonition. But the market downturn has raised concerns among other financial experts. The decline in the global stock market that began in the U. S. spilled over to Japan, and the Nikkei 225 and Topix indices fell sharply.
